In order to address the issue of fluctuations caused by the large-scale integration of wind and solar energy into the grid, this study proposes a multi-energy complementary system of wind-solar-hydrogen hybrid by combining wind-solar hybrid power generation, electrolytic water hydrogen production, and fuel cell system.
The United States, China, and the United Kingdom also register initiatives to develop hybrid wind–solar plants. In the Brazilian electricity sector, the generator and the Independent System Operator celebrate a contract to allow connecting the power plant to the transmission system.
This hybrid system can take advantage of the complementary nature of solar and wind energy: solar panels produce more electricity during sunny days when the wind might not be blowing, and wind turbines can generate electricity at night or during cloudy days when solar panels are less effective.
